My mare has been unshod behind for a number of years. We lightly hacked with no problems and my blacksmith was happy enough that her feet were maintaining well enough.
We have moved down to Cheshire now and our hacking involves A LOT of roadwork, so her feet have worn down very quickly - looks like she will have to start wearing shoes behind as I don't want her to start struggling.
New farrier had a look and because I have been hacking most days, the foot is currently too short to take a shoe so he has advised no roadwork at all for two weeks and he will come back with some shoes he will manufacture for her. He seems like a great blacksmith, spoke a lot of sense and I have had nothing but recommendations from other liveries so am confident he can sort them out.
I have bought some cornucrescine which I am applying twice daily. She is turned out every day from 7am-6pm and fed a net of hay at night, plus a scoop of alfaA molasses free, a small scoop of speedi-beet, an all round vitmin supplement, turmeric, black pepper and soya oil.
Does anyone have any recommendations for hoof growth? She is a welshie so actually has very good feet, but they just aren't going to stand up to the constant wear of roadwork. The turnout situation is 100% better than my old yard too, so I think the more regular turnout is also probably wearing her foot down more quickly....any topical or dietary recommendations would be great!
